A slight deformity of the foot can result in a bunion, which is the irritation and inflammation of the joint at the base of the big toe. When the disorder develops, the big toe overrides with the next toe(s) and the joint protrudes. A bunion is often subjected to constant rubbing, which makes walking painful and difficult.
To prevent this, always wear correctly fitting shoes.
Avoid high-heeled and pointed shoes.
